Top 3 Best Wilcox County Public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 3 public schools serving 1,173 students in Wilcox County, GA (there are , serving 15 private students). 99% of all K-12 students in Wilcox County, GA are educated in public schools (compared to the GA state average of 91%).
The top ranked public schools in Wilcox County, GA are Wilcox County High School, Wilcox County Middle School and Wilcox County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Wilcox County, GA public schools have an average math proficiency score of 46% (versus the Georgia public school average of 38%), and reading proficiency score of 35% (versus the 40% statewide average). Schools in Wilcox County have an average ranking of 7/10, which is in the top 50% of Georgia public schools.
Minority enrollment is 42%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Georgia public school average of 65% (majority Black).
